javascript - 加载 twitter 推文 410 错误

标签 javascript jquery twitter tweets

我在加载推文时遇到问题。我想加载 ex 的推文。来自“BachelorGDM”。 ( https://twitter.com/BachelorGDM )

这是我在 javascript 文件中所做的:

var url = 'https://api.twitter.com/1/statuses/user_timeline/BachelorGDM.json?callback=twitterCallback2&count=4';

var script = document.createElement('script');  
    script.setAttribute('src', url);
    document.body.appendChild(script);

function twitterCallback(tweets)
{
    console.log(tweets);
}

当我尝试这个时,我得到了这个错误:

GET https://api.twitter.com/1/statuses/user_timeline/BachelorGDM.json?callback=twitterCallback2&count=4 410 (Gone)

奇怪的是,这在昨天有效:/
我已经尝试加载来自另一个用户的推文,但响应相同。

有人知道我做错了什么吗?

最佳答案

如果你打开your url在浏览器中,它说:

The Twitter REST API v1 will soon stop functioning. Please migrate to API v1.1. https://dev.twitter.com/docs/api/1.1/overview.

因此,您需要使用较新的版本。

关于javascript - 加载 twitter 推文 410 错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17064747/

相关文章:

Twitter API,获取 Tweet 作为图像

java - 是否可以使用 Twitter4j 库从特定用户获取 Twitter 的直接消息?

javascript - 如何在JSON.stringify : Uncaught TypeError: Converting circular structure to JSON?中找到循环结构

用于初始化私有(private)变量的 Javascript 构造函数

php - 如何通过同时提供 INDEX 将值分配给 JSON

javascript - 如何处理 iPad 等移动设备上的悬停?

C# Twitter 和 Restsharp 身份验证

javascript - Highcharts——在最边缘显示轴标签

Javascript 在按钮单击时将 div 转换为表单

javascript - 添加后选择部分文本